HI, kinda late to the party. I'm in a similar rut with intercontinental internet issues, and would like to share my thoughts
While not a full-fledged CDN, you may consider setting up an Asian VPS to serve as a second reverse proxy/ingress route, terminate TLS there, and route plaintext HTTP back to your homelab (this virtual tunnel shall be behind a WireGuard VPN interface). As I've figured out in my blogpost here (see scenario 2), this allows the initial TCP and TLS handshakes to happen nearer to the user instead of going all the way to Europe and back home.
You can consider setting up a separate Jellyfin instance for Asia, but of course that comes with setting up syncing media, maintaining separate user credentials, and so on. So before renting compute, I suggest trying these smaller actions first - if they work you mightn't need a VPS anymore:
